
In a quest to further bridge real-world motorsport with virtual racing, iRacing announced they have reached a multi-year agreement with Cosworth to incorporate the acclaimed Cosworth Pi Toolbox to be used as the official data analysis platform of iRacing.
The Cosworth Pi Toolbox is the same real-time data technology used in IndyCar and WEC, enabling instant data sharing between drivers, engineers, and coaches.
The feature will be freely available for all active iRacing users. Alongside the PC version, the Cosworth branding will also be extended to iRacing’s upcoming console games on PlayStation and Xbox ecosystems, including iRacing Arcade, and the upcoming officially licensed NASCAR and IndyCar games.
Furthermore, iRacing officially announced new iRacing competition formats to be launched this September, including the ‘Cosworth Cup’ series, and a new series for the upcoming iRacing Arcade version.
The iRacing / Cosworth partnership will officially be unveiled at iRacing’s season launch on 9 September, with series participation and Pi Toolbox access going live from 16 September.
For avid motorsport fans, the name Cosworth needs no introduction. The British automotive engineering company has a rich history specializing in high-performance internal combustion engines, powertrains, and electronics for the motorsport industry.
Most noticeably, Cosworth racked up 176 wins in Formula One as an engine supplier. Cosworth also manufactures a lineup of high-tech racing car steering wheels, such as the CCW Mk2, CCW Mk3, and the CAN Formula steering wheel.
